// Code generated by private/model/cli/gen-api/main.go. DO NOT EDIT.
package ec2
import (
"context"
"github.com/aws/aws-sdk-go-v2/aws"
"github.com/aws/aws-sdk-go-v2/internal/awsutil"
)
type GetAssociatedIpv6PoolCidrsInput struct {
_ struct{} `type:"structure"`
// Checks whether you have the required permissions for the action, without
// actually making the request, and provides an error response. If you have
// the required permissions, the error response is DryRunOperation. Otherwise,
// it is UnauthorizedOperation.
DryRun *bool `type:"boolean"`
// The maximum number of results to return with a single call. To retrieve the
// remaining results, make another call with the returned nextToken value.
MaxResults *int64 `min:"1" type:"integer"`
// The token for the next page of results.
NextToken *string `type:"string"`
// The ID of the IPv6 address pool.
//
// PoolId is a required field
PoolId *string `type:"string" required:"true"`
}
// String returns the string representation
func (s GetAssociatedIpv6PoolCidrsInput) String() string {
return awsutil.Prettify(s)
}
// Validate inspects the fields of the type to determine if they are valid.
func (s *GetAssociatedIpv6PoolCidrsInput) Validate() error {
invalidParams := aws.ErrInvalidParams{Context: "GetAssociatedIpv6PoolCidrsInput"}
if s.MaxResults != nil && *s.MaxResults < 1 {
invalidParams.Add(aws.NewErrParamMinValue("MaxResults", 1))
}
if s.PoolId == nil {
invalidParams.Add(aws.NewErrParamRequired("PoolId"))
}
if invalidParams.Len() > 0 {
return invalidParams
}
return nil
}
type GetAssociatedIpv6PoolCidrsOutput struct {
_ struct{} `type:"structure"`
// Information about the IPv6 CIDR block associations.
Ipv6CidrAssociations []Ipv6CidrAssociation `locationName:"ipv6CidrAssociationSet" locationNameList:"item" type:"list"`
// The token to use to retrieve the next page of results. This value is null
// when there are no more results to return.
NextToken *string `locationName:"nextToken" type:"string"`
}
// String returns the string representation
func (s GetAssociatedIpv6PoolCidrsOutput) String() string {
return awsutil.Prettify(s)
}
const opGetAssociatedIpv6PoolCidrs = "GetAssociatedIpv6PoolCidrs"
// GetAssociatedIpv6PoolCidrsRequest returns a request value for making API operation for
// Amazon Elastic Compute Cloud.
//
// Gets information about the IPv6 CIDR block associations for a specified IPv6
// address pool.
//
// // Example sending a request using GetAssociatedIpv6PoolCidrsRequest.
// req := client.GetAssociatedIpv6PoolCidrsRequest(params)
// resp, err := req.Send(context.TODO())
// if err == nil {
// fmt.Println(resp)
// }
//
// Please also see https://docs.aws.amazon.com/goto/WebAPI/ec2-2016-11-15/GetAssociatedIpv6PoolCidrs
func (c *Client) GetAssociatedIpv6PoolCidrsRequest(input *GetAssociatedIpv6PoolCidrsInput) GetAssociatedIpv6PoolCidrsRequest {
op := &aws.Operation{
Name: opGetAssociatedIpv6PoolCidrs,
HTTPMethod: "POST",
HTTPPath: "/",
Paginator: &aws.Paginator{
InputTokens: []string{"NextToken"},
OutputTokens: []string{"NextToken"},
LimitToken: "MaxResults",
TruncationToken: "",
},
}
if input == nil {
input = &GetAssociatedIpv6PoolCidrsInput{}
}
req := c.newRequest(op, input, &GetAssociatedIpv6PoolCidrsOutput{})
return GetAssociatedIpv6PoolCidrsRequest{Request: req, Input: input, Copy: c.GetAssociatedIpv6PoolCidrsRequest}
}
// GetAssociatedIpv6PoolCidrsRequest is the request type for the
// GetAssociatedIpv6PoolCidrs API operation.
type GetAssociatedIpv6PoolCidrsRequest struct {
*aws.Request
Input *GetAssociatedIpv6PoolCidrsInput
Copy func(*GetAssociatedIpv6PoolCidrsInput) GetAssociatedIpv6PoolCidrsRequest
}
// Send marshals and sends the GetAssociatedIpv6PoolCidrs API request.
func (r GetAssociatedIpv6PoolCidrsRequest) Send(ctx context.Context) (*GetAssociatedIpv6PoolCidrsResponse, error) {
r.Request.SetContext(ctx)
err := r.Request.Send()
if err != nil {
return nil, err
}
resp := &GetAssociatedIpv6PoolCidrsResponse{
GetAssociatedIpv6PoolCidrsOutput: r.Request.Data.(*GetAssociatedIpv6PoolCidrsOutput),
response: &aws.Response{Request: r.Request},
}
return resp, nil
}
// NewGetAssociatedIpv6PoolCidrsRequestPaginator returns a paginator for GetAssociatedIpv6PoolCidrs.
// Use Next method to get the next page, and CurrentPage to get the current
// response page from the paginator. Next will return false, if there are
// no more pages, or an error was encountered.
//
// Note: This operation can generate multiple requests to a service.
//
// // Example iterating over pages.
// req := client.GetAssociatedIpv6PoolCidrsRequest(input)
// p := ec2.NewGetAssociatedIpv6PoolCidrsRequestPaginator(req)
//
// for p.Next(context.TODO()) {
// page := p.CurrentPage()
// }
//
// if err := p.Err(); err != nil {
// return err
// }
//
func NewGetAssociatedIpv6PoolCidrsPaginator(req GetAssociatedIpv6PoolCidrsRequest) GetAssociatedIpv6PoolCidrsPaginator {
return GetAssociatedIpv6PoolCidrsPaginator{
Pager: aws.Pager{
NewRequest: func(ctx context.Context) (*aws.Request, error) {
var inCpy *GetAssociatedIpv6PoolCidrsInput
if req.Input != nil {
tmp := *req.Input
inCpy = &tmp
}
newReq := req.Copy(inCpy)
newReq.SetContext(ctx)
return newReq.Request, nil
},
},
}
}
// GetAssociatedIpv6PoolCidrsPaginator is used to paginate the request. This can be done by
// calling Next and CurrentPage.
type GetAssociatedIpv6PoolCidrsPaginator struct {
aws.Pager
}
func (p *GetAssociatedIpv6PoolCidrsPaginator) CurrentPage() *GetAssociatedIpv6PoolCidrsOutput {
return p.Pager.CurrentPage().(*GetAssociatedIpv6PoolCidrsOutput)
}
// GetAssociatedIpv6PoolCidrsResponse is the response type for the
// GetAssociatedIpv6PoolCidrs API operation.
type GetAssociatedIpv6PoolCidrsResponse struct {
*GetAssociatedIpv6PoolCidrsOutput
response *aws.Response
}
// SDKResponseMetdata returns the response metadata for the
// GetAssociatedIpv6PoolCidrs request.
func (r *GetAssociatedIpv6PoolCidrsResponse) SDKResponseMetdata() *aws.Response {
return r.response
}
